Title of article :
A Matrix Approach for General Higher Order Linear Recurrences
Author/Authors :
Kilic, Emrah TOBB Economics and Technology University - Mathematics Department, Turkey , Stanica, Pantelimon Naval Postgraduate School - Applied Mathematics Department, USA
Abstract :
We consider k sequences of generalized order-k linear recurrences with arbitrary initial conditions and coefficients, and we give their generalized Binet formulas and generating functions. We also obtain a new matrix method to derive explicit formulas for the sums of terms of the k sequences. Further, some relationships between determinants of certain Hessenberg matrices and the terms of these sequences are obtained.
